5 Electric fields E are caused by charges.
Magnetic fields B are caused by moving charges.

6 Current 电流 - - - - - - - - - - - -
The electron current is the number of electrons per second that enter a section of a conductor.

7 Current 电流 - + + + + + + + + + + + + + +
We usually pretend that positive charges are moving. (Sometimes this is true!)

8 Current 电流 + + + + + + + + + + + + + +
Conventional current i is the amount of (positive) charge per second that enters a section of conductor. Its direction is opposite that of the electron current.

9 Current 电流 + + + + + + + + + + + + + +
Units of current: Coulombs/second, or amperes

10 An electric current can deflect a compass needle.

11 An electric current can deflect a compass needle.

12 There is no deflection if the current is perpendicular to the compass.

13 The direction of the deflection depends on if the current is above or below the compass.

14 The direction of the deflection depends on the direction of the current.

15 How can we explain these experiments?
By a field that curls around the current-carrying wire.
